2015-04-02 60 views
0

我正在尋找從我的Java應用程序中編寫一些PDF和RTF文件。我可以使用模板,因此這些字母樣式報告在我將一些佔位符替換爲數據的字母樣式報表之間有所不同,對於爲每行數據動態添加表格/子表格的表格格式重複使用。用Java代碼輸出格式化的PDF和RTF

是否有一個很好的工具,做所有這些事情,以減少學習曲線,

寫RTF和PDF格式 中,替換佔位符讀出的模板&保存文檔 創造更多的傳統的重複報告?

我讀了一個不同的答案,賈斯帕可能做這個工作,但這是一個相當古老的問題,所以我想我會看看它是否仍然是一個好工具?

+0

*中,替換佔位符*閱讀模板 - 在PDF文件的情況下,也就是一個壞主意。不用於編輯內容。 – mkl 2015-04-02 22:55:11

+0

是的,但模板可以是任何格式。例如,如果它是一個dotNet應用程序,我可能會用MS Word文件模板完成所有操作,然後用SaveAs x.pdf或x.rtf完成。我有這樣的印象,賈斯珀可能提供這種能力,但希望有人能夠在我投擲時間之前確認/否認這一點?!例如,Apache OpenOffice可能是一個更好的選擇嗎?說實話,我沒有任何經驗,我希望確保我不會浪費太多的時間/天來調查不提供我需要的功能的庫。有任何想法嗎? – gringogordo 2015-04-03 10:19:57

回答

0

經過了一段時間的討論,我會增加說賈斯珀報告的人數。原因包括簡單,免費,開箱即用的OO/Uno是32位,我在64位Windows環境下運行。 Apose看起來像OO/Uno的一個很好的替代方案(實現),但是因爲它花費很多現金,我沒有對它進行評估。

不知道這個答案是值得很多,但因爲沒有其他人已經回答了,我想我扔掉我的經驗和「關閉」的問題